When the pride of Wisconsin resigns, when Paul Ryan puts down the gavel and exits the speaker’s office, an era will end.

It wasn’t long ago that Wisconsin wielded oversized influence in national politics. At the beginning of the decade, the Washington Post reported that the state “could shape the direction of the GOP.”
